Antique William IV Period Mahogany and Leather Caned Armchair
A beautiful and very well made antique William IV period mahogany and leather caned armchair. This was made in England, it dates from around the 1830-1840 period.
It is of very fine quality, the solid mahogany frame has beautifully carved scrolled armrests, it sits on carved baluster legs with brass casters. The proportions are lovely, and it is very comfortable as well.
We have had the frame re-polished, the cane is all in good order. The feather filled leather cushion has been newly made in a hand dyed brown leather. The condition is excellent for its age, with normal surface wear and patina to be expected on a period piece.
